日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区

您的位置:首頁技術文章
文章詳情頁

MySQL利用索引優化ORDER BY排序語句的方法

瀏覽:23日期:2023-10-10 15:07:33

創建表&創建索引

create table tbl1 (id int unique, sname varchar(50),index tbl1_index_sname(sname desc));

在已有的表創建索引語法

create [unique|fulltext|spatial] index 索引名 on 表名(字段名 [長度] [asc|desc]);

MySQL也能利用索引來快速地執行ORDER BY和GROUP BY語句的排序和分組操作。

通過索引優化來實現MySQL的ORDER BY語句優化:

1、ORDER BY的索引優化

如果一個SQL語句形如:

SELECT [column1],[column2],…. FROM [TABLE] ORDER BY [sort];

在[sort]這個欄位上建立索引就可以實現利用索引進行order by 優化。

2、WHERE + ORDER BY的索引優化

形如:

SELECT [column1],[column2],…. FROM [TABLE] WHERE [columnX] = [value] ORDER BY [sort];

建立一個聯合索引(columnX,sort)來實現order by 優化。

注意:如果columnX對應多個值,如下面語句就無法利用索引來實現order by的優化

SELECT [column1],[column2],…. FROM [TABLE] WHERE [columnX] IN ([value1],[value2],…) ORDER BY[sort];

3、WHERE+ 多個字段ORDER BY

SELECT * FROM [table] WHERE uid=1 ORDER x,y LIMIT 0,10;

建立索引(uid,x,y)實現order by的優化,比建立(x,y,uid)索引效果要好得多。

MySQL Order By不能使用索引來優化排序的情況

1. 對不同的索引鍵做 ORDER BY :(key1,key2分別建立索引)

SELECT * FROM t1 ORDER BY key1, key2;

2. 在非連續的索引鍵部分上做 ORDER BY:(key_part1,key_part2建立聯合索引;key2建立索引)

SELECT * FROM t1 WHERE key2=constant ORDER BY key_part2;

3. 同時使用了 ASC 和 DESC:(key_part1,key_part2建立聯合索引)

SELECT * FROM t1 ORDER BY key_part1 DESC, key_part2 ASC;

4. 用于搜索記錄的索引鍵和做 ORDER BY 的不是同一個:(key1,key2分別建立索引)

SELECT * FROM t1 WHERE key2=constant ORDER BY key1;

5. 如果在WHERE和ORDER BY的欄位上應用表達式(函數)時,則無法利用索引來實現order by的優化

SELECT * FROM t1 ORDER BY YEAR(logindate) LIMIT 0,10;

特別提示:

1>mysql一次查詢只能使用一個索引。如果要對多個字段使用索引,建立復合索引。

2>在ORDER BY操作中,MySQL只有在排序條件不是一個查詢條件表達式的情況下才使用索引。

以上就是MySQL利用索引優化ORDER BY排序語句的方法的詳細內容,更多關于MySQL 優化ORDER BY排序語句的資料請關注好吧啦網其它相關文章!

標簽: MySQL 數據庫
相關文章:
日本不卡不码高清免费观看,久久国产精品久久w女人spa,黄色aa久久,三上悠亚国产精品一区二区三区
欧美中文字幕| 中文不卡在线| 欧美久久久网站| 国产精品一在线观看| 国产乱子精品一区二区在线观看| 日韩欧美中文字幕在线视频| 国产欧美自拍一区| 久久九九精品| 日本在线不卡视频| 91欧美在线| 性色av一区二区怡红| 亚洲精品成a人ⅴ香蕉片| 久久久国产精品入口麻豆| 成人在线免费观看网站| 蜜臀av性久久久久蜜臀aⅴ流畅 | 日韩在线黄色| 99国产精品久久久久久久| 日韩午夜视频在线| 亚洲韩日在线| 在线亚洲精品| 石原莉奈在线亚洲三区| 欧美三区不卡| 精品理论电影在线| 久久精品国产一区二区| 中国字幕a在线看韩国电影| 日本一区福利在线| 日本强好片久久久久久aaa| 国产欧美日韩| 免费在线亚洲欧美| 四季av一区二区凹凸精品| 欧美一级二区| 日韩美女国产精品| 国产精品美女久久久久久不卡| 国产精品美女久久久久久不卡| 亚洲黄页一区| 久久最新视频| 丝袜美腿一区二区三区| 人在线成免费视频| 久久久国产精品网站| 日韩在线成人| 夜久久久久久| 中文字幕高清在线播放| 亚洲最新av| 久久午夜精品一区二区| 国产综合婷婷| 国产免费成人| 伊人影院久久| 亚洲在线观看| 亚洲精品裸体| 国产精品夜夜夜| 国产91欧美| 另类专区亚洲| 不卡在线一区二区| 亚洲成人一区在线观看| 久久午夜精品一区二区| 亚洲专区在线| 国产日本亚洲| 午夜国产精品视频| 欧美精品1区| 国产视频久久| 国产一级久久| 99久久久久久中文字幕一区| 激情中国色综合| 影音先锋国产精品| 婷婷精品进入| 久久久久久黄| 99久久婷婷| 黄色不卡一区| 麻豆成全视频免费观看在线看| 免费在线观看日韩欧美| 国产调教一区二区三区| 亚洲人亚洲人色久| 日韩av有码| 日韩欧美自拍| 香蕉成人av| 99视频一区| 日韩中文av| 国内揄拍国内精品久久| 香蕉久久99| 日韩一区二区三区高清在线观看| 国产精品美女午夜爽爽| 亚洲成人精品| 国产精品久久免费视频| 国产精品入口久久| 国产精品一区二区精品视频观看 | 免费观看在线综合| 99国产精品| 久久av在线| 欧美精品三级在线| 久久久久久黄| 久久xxxx精品视频| 久热re这里精品视频在线6| 免费一级片91| 97成人在线| 午夜日韩福利| 国产亚洲精aa在线看| 国产精久久久| 91欧美在线| 一本色道精品久久一区二区三区| 日韩avvvv在线播放| 老司机免费视频一区二区三区| 亚洲美洲欧洲综合国产一区| 成人免费电影网址| 日韩中文字幕不卡| 国产精品手机在线播放| 日韩一区二区三区免费| 日本在线高清| 免费人成精品欧美精品| 久久精品国产99国产| 蜜桃tv一区二区三区| 久久国产精品美女| 视频在线观看国产精品| 国产精品久久久久久久久免费高清 | 视频一区二区三区中文字幕| 性欧美精品高清| 亚洲精品三级| 欧美激情三区| 久久久噜噜噜| 亚洲精品婷婷| а√天堂8资源在线| 日韩视频一二区| 国产精品白丝久久av网站| 国产调教一区二区三区| 日韩精品影视| 在线亚洲自拍| 97精品一区| 五月激情久久| 精品一区电影| 亚洲一区欧美激情| 成人在线视频区| 91久久亚洲| 亚洲精品四区| 国产一区二区三区免费在线| 亚洲一区国产| 日本中文字幕一区二区| 国产伦精品一区二区三区千人斩| 久久亚州av| 成人自拍av| 国产一区二区三区不卡视频网站 | 日韩精品1区| 日韩动漫一区| 国内激情久久| 婷婷六月综合| 国产精品av一区二区| 日韩深夜视频| 久久精品色播| 成人午夜在线| 美女毛片一区二区三区四区最新中文字幕亚洲| av资源新版天堂在线| 久久精品国产精品亚洲毛片| 国产不卡人人| 久久精品影视| 蜜臀久久99精品久久久久久9| 久久国产精品99国产| 亚洲高清av| 久久精品国产福利| 国产成人a视频高清在线观看| 精品中文字幕一区二区三区| 老司机免费视频一区二区三区| 亚洲一区二区三区四区电影 | 亚洲欧美不卡| 国产日韩在线观看视频| 国精品产品一区| 亚洲国产综合在线看不卡| 久久一二三区| 国产96在线亚洲| 精精国产xxxx视频在线播放| 私拍精品福利视频在线一区| 免费在线小视频| 蜜桃精品在线| 色婷婷色综合| 日韩欧美1区| 国产一区清纯| 午夜国产一区二区| 欧美专区一区| 天堂va欧美ⅴa亚洲va一国产| 日本亚洲三级在线| аⅴ资源天堂资源库在线| 亚洲国产综合在线看不卡| 午夜性色一区二区三区免费视频| 精品中文在线| 欧美日一区二区| 国产麻豆精品久久| 亚洲成a人片| 国产一区二区三区四区五区| 日韩成人高清| 日韩欧美中文在线观看| 高清av不卡| 国产96在线亚洲| 国产精品天天看天天狠| 综合激情视频| 精品丝袜在线| 久久精品国产成人一区二区三区| 国产成人精品三级高清久久91| 蜜臀av免费一区二区三区| 亚洲18在线| 一区二区国产精品| 黄色亚洲精品| 亚洲精品观看| 国产极品嫩模在线观看91精品|